The National Council of Youth Organizations in Korea (NCYOK) is organising the Voice of ASEAN-Korea Youths as part of the side event leading to the ASEAN-Korea Youth Summit.

 The Voice of ASAN-Korea Youths aims to create a platform for ASEAN-Korea youth to exchange opinions on the latest global issues and for the youth to have better insights on the issues from a subject-matter expert. NCYOK will provide a certificate of Participation to participants who successfully participate in the program.

 The schedules are as follows:

📌Date/Time: Thursday, May 27, 2021/ 15:00-16:00 KST

📌Registration Period: Thursday, May 6 – Sunday, May 23

📌Participants: 40 Youths from ASEAN and Korea

📌Platform: Zoom

📌Program: Presentation by Expert and Interview, Open Discussion, Q&A, Commemorative Photo

* Participation is free of charge
